CuttleFish: Oxford’s Premier Seafood Experience on St Clement’s Street

Fresh, beautifully cooked seafood with a relaxed vibe in the heart of Oxford’s vibrant St Clement’s district.

★★★★★4.5 (729)

CuttleFish is a celebrated seafood restaurant located on St Clement’s Street in Oxford, known for its fresh, beautifully cooked fish and diverse menu including classic British seafood dishes and Mediterranean influences. The venue offers a relaxed, informal atmosphere with friendly service, making it a favored spot for both locals and visitors seeking quality seafood at moderate prices.

    Getting There

    Bus

    Take the Oxford Bus Company service 3 or 4 from the city center towards Headington; the journey takes approximately 15-20 minutes. Alight near St Clement’s Street. Buses run frequently throughout the day, with single fares around £2.50.

    Taxi

    A taxi ride from Oxford city center to CuttleFish typically takes 5-10 minutes depending on traffic, costing approximately £7-£12. Taxis are readily available and provide a convenient door-to-door option.

    Walking

    From Oxford city center, a pleasant 20-25 minute walk along the High Street and over Magdalen Bridge leads to St Clement’s Street. The route is mostly flat and suitable for wheelchair users.

    Local tips

    Try the Fritto Misto, widely regarded as a family favorite and a highlight of the menu.
    Book ahead for dinner, especially on weekends, to secure a table in this popular spot.
    Explore the daily specials for seasonal seafood dishes that showcase fresh, local ingredients.
    Non-seafood eaters can enjoy quality burgers and vegetarian options available on the menu.

    Discover more about CuttleFish

    A Culinary Haven for Seafood Lovers

    Nestled just across Magdalen Bridge, CuttleFish has established itself as a standout destination for seafood enthusiasts in Oxford. The restaurant prides itself on serving fresh fish cooked simply to perfection, with an emphasis on quality and flavor rather than fuss. Signature dishes include the exceptional Fritto Misto, fresh Devon oysters, Canadian lobsters, and seafood paella with black Venus rice. The menu also caters to non-seafood eaters with options like burgers and a decent range of vegetarian dishes, ensuring a broad appeal.

    Atmosphere and Service

    CuttleFish maintains a relaxed and informal vibe, making it a comfortable setting for a casual meal or a special occasion. The staff are known for being friendly, attentive, and accommodating, contributing to a welcoming dining experience. While some guests have noted that seating could be more comfortable, the overall ambiance is warm and inviting, with a steady flow of patrons that speaks to its popularity.

    Location and Setting

    Situated at 36-37 St Clement’s Street, the restaurant benefits from a convenient location near Oxford’s city center and just a short walk from Magdalen Bridge. This positioning makes it easily accessible while allowing diners to enjoy views of the vibrant St Clement’s area. The interior design is simple and unpretentious, focusing attention on the food and service rather than elaborate decor.

    Menu Highlights and Value

    The menu at CuttleFish is praised for its variety and quality. Daily specials offer interesting and seasonal seafood options, and the cod and chips are often highlighted as a must-try classic. Prices are considered moderate, offering good value for the quality of ingredients and preparation. Drinks include a well-curated wine list with bottles starting around £20, alongside cocktails and non-alcoholic options.

    Commitment to Quality and Recognition

    CuttleFish has earned accolades such as the 2025/26 Blue Ribbon from the Good Food Award, reflecting its high standards in food quality, service, and value. The restaurant’s commitment to sourcing fresh seafood and delivering consistently well-prepared dishes has made it a trusted choice for both locals and visitors.

    Accessibility and Practical Information

    Open daily with extended hours, CuttleFish welcomes guests from 11 am to 10:30 pm on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 10 am to 9:30 pm on Sundays. The venue is wheelchair accessible and offers table service, making it suitable for a wide range of diners. While reservations are recommended during peak times, the restaurant’s steady flow ensures a lively yet manageable dining environment.
